Potential Effects Of Getting Doored
The "door area" is the room of 2-4 feet adjacent to parallel parked, double parked, or quit vehicles. While cycling in the "door area," a cyclist can endure an extreme injury and even death if a door is suddenly opened right into their course of travel. Obtaining struck by an automobile door can lead to disastrous injuries, especially if you are cycling at a broadband.
As result, many biking professionals concur that bikers ought to try to ride a minimum of five feet away from parallel parked cars and trucks. Dooring mishaps stay regular, so Chicago passed a statute against opening an automobile door without very first monitoring for oncoming website traffic. The Municipal Code of Chicago states that no individual will open the door of a lorry on the side of moving traffic unless doing so does not disrupt the movement of various other website traffic and it is risk-free to do so. Anybody exiting the automobile on the traffic side is expected to verify the Best auto accident lawyer near me method is clear. Laws additionally define that a door can not be exposed on the side of moving web traffic longer than necessary to lots or discharge passengers. Under the comparative carelessness rule, you can get only a section of the compensation available for your bike crash. For instance, if you are located to be 30% responsible for the accident, you will only obtain 70% of the granted compensation.
What Is A Dooring Accident?
One situation is frequently referred to as "dooring." Dooring refers to what occurs when somebody in a cars and truck opens the door and hits a bicyclist who's passing where the door is opened.
